Khadi Prakritik Paint is India’s first natural, cow dung-based wall paint, developed by the Khadi and Village Industries Commission (KVIC). Inspired by the traditional Indian practice of coating walls and floors with cow dung, this innovation blends ancient wisdom with modern technology. It plays a multi-faceted role in India’s economic, environmental, and rural landscapes:

  1. Environmental Stewardship (Eco-Friendly & Non-Toxic): Traditional synthetic paints contain high levels of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s) and dangerous heavy metals (like lead, mercury, chromium, and arsenic). Khadi Prakritik Paint contains negligible VOCs, is entirely chemical-free, and leaves a much smaller carbon footprint, heavily contributing to sustainable architecture and green building practices in India.
  2. Promoting Rural Economy & Farmer Income: By transforming cow dung—a heavily available farm agricultural residue—into a commercial raw material, the paint provides a vital, steady secondary income stream for local farmers and gaushalas (cow shelters).
  3. Public Health and Well-being (Ashta Laabh): The paint offers eight distinct natural benefits (Ashta Laabh), including being naturally anti-bacterial, anti-fungal, odorless, and acting as a natural thermal insulator (keeping interiors c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ter).
  4. Fostering Decentralized Entrepreneurship: KVIC does not strictly centralize production. Instead, it transfers the manufacturing technology via licensed agreements to local entrepreneurs, creating jobs and supporting local manufacturing hubs across different states.

What is Prakratik Paint?

Prakratik Paint (literally translating to “Natural Paint”) is an innovative, non-toxic paint developed primarily using cow dung as its main ingredient. While the idea of using cow dung on walls might sound primitive, this is a sophisticated, scientifically processed product launched by the Khadi and Village Industries Commission (KVIC) in India.

Through a refined manufacturing process, the dung is treated to remove any odor and bacteria, leaving behind a clean, fibrous base. This base is then mixed with natural binders and pigments to create a high-quality paint that looks and performs just like its chemical counterparts.

It generally comes in two variants:

  1. Distemper Paint: Ideal for interior walls with a matte finish.
  2. Emulsion Paint: A premium, washable finish suitable for both interior and exterior surfaces.

The Key Benefits of Prakratik Paint

The shift toward natural paint isn’t just about being “green”; it’s about creating a healthier living environment and supporting a sustainable economy.

1. Non-Toxic and VOC-Free

Standard paints release VOCs, which are responsible for that “new paint smell” but can cause headaches, nausea, and respiratory issues. Prakratik Paint is free from heavy metals (like lead, mercury, and chromium) and contains zero toxic chemicals, making it safe for children, pets, and the elderly.

2. Natural Thermal Insulation

One of the most impressive properties of cow dung is its natural insulating ability. Walls coated with Prakratik Paint act as a thermal buffer, keeping interiors c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ter. This can lead to a noticeable reduction in air conditioning and heating costs.

3. Anti-Bacterial and Anti-Fungal

Cow dung has been used in traditional Indian households for centuries due to its natural disinfectant properties. Modern Prakratik Paint retains these anti-bacterial and anti-fungal qualities, preventing the growth of mold and mildew on damp walls—a common problem with synthetic paints.

4. Cost-Effective and Durable

Contrary to the belief that “natural” means “expensive,” Prakratik Paint is priced competitively with mid-range chemical paints. It offers excellent coverage and a long lifespan, typically lasting 3 to 5 years before needing a refresh.

5. Environmentally Sustainable

The production of chemical paint is a carbon-heavy process. Prakratik Paint, however:

  • Reduces the carbon footprint of the building industry.
  • Is biodegradable.
  • Provides a secondary source of income for farmers and gaushalas (cow shelters), encouraging better animal welfare.

Cow Dung Paint in India https://sidvig.com/cow-dung-paint-in-india-2/ Wed, 11 Feb 2026 16:49:44 +0000 https://sidvig.com/blog/?p=119 In India, the ancient tradition of using cow dung to coat the walls of rural homes has been reborn as a modern, high-tech solution. Known as Khadi Prakritik Paint, this innovation is a result of blending traditional Indian wisdom with contemporary science to create an eco-friendly alternative to chemical-laden paints.+1

Launched officially in 2021 by the Khadi and Village Industries Commission (KVIC), cow dung paint is now being hailed as a “green revolution” in the Indian construction and decor industry.


What is Cow Dung Paint?

Cow dung paint is a non-toxic, water-based paint where processed cow dung serves as the primary raw material. Unlike traditional “gobar” coatings that are applied raw, modern Prakritik paint undergoes a rigorous manufacturing process to become an odorless, smooth emulsion or distemper.+1

The Science Behind It

The paint is primarily composed of Carboxymethyl Cellulose (CMC) derived from cow dung.

  • Cellulose & Lignin: These natural fibers provide excellent adhesion and UV resistance.
  • Natural Binders: Ingredients like lime (calcium carbonate), neem extracts, and plant-based gums (e.g., Moringa gum) are used to ensure durability.
  • Pigments: It is available in a white base that can be mixed with any colorant to create over 800 shades.

Key Benefits: The “Ashta Laabh” (8 Benefits)

The Indian government and manufacturers often market this paint under the “Ashta Laabh” framework, highlighting eight specific advantages:

  1. Anti-Bacterial & Anti-Fungal: Cow dung has inherent antimicrobial properties that prevent the growth of mold and harmful bacteria on walls.
  2. Thermal Insulation: It acts as a natural heat shield, keeping interiors 4–5°C c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ter.
  3. Non-Toxic & Eco-Friendly: It is free from heavy metals like lead, mercury, chromium, and arsenic, which are common in synthetic paints.
  4. Odorless: Despite its source, the final product is completely odorless and even helps purify indoor air.
  5. Cost-Effective: It is generally 20–30% cheaper than leading commercial brands.
  6. Washable & Durable: Modern formulations are BIS-certified (Bureau of Indian Standards) and can be cleaned with water just like plastic emulsions.
  7. Positive Vastu/Spiritual Energy: Many Indian consumers value it for its traditional “shubh” (auspicious) properties and its ability to reduce radiation.
  8. Economic Empowerment: It creates a revenue stream for farmers, who can sell raw cow dung for approximately ₹5 per kg.

How It Is Made: The Manufacturing Process

The transition from “waste” to “wall paint” involves several sophisticated steps:

  • Refining: Fresh cow dung is mixed with water and processed in a triple-disc refiner to create a fine, smooth pulp.
  • Bleaching & Treatment: The pulp is bleached (often using hydrogen peroxide) to turn it white and neutralize any odor. This process extracts the CMC.
  • Formulation: The treated base is mixed with calcium carbonate, binders, and natural preservatives like neem to prevent spoilage.
  • Grinding: The mixture is ground into a fine paste to ensure a uniform, high-quality finish.

Where Is It Being Used?

Cow dung paint has moved beyond rural huts into diverse modern settings:

  • Government Buildings: States like Chhattisgarh have mandated the use of cow dung paint for all government offices and schools to support local self-help groups.
  • Eco-Resorts & Heritage Hotels: Architects focusing on sustainable “Green Buildings” use it for its rustic texture and cooling properties.
  • Residential Homes: Urban homeowners seeking “low-VOC” (Volatile Organic Compound) options for kids’ rooms or allergy-safe environments.
  • Temples & Religious Sites: Used to maintain the sanctity and traditional aesthetic of spiritual spaces.

Regional Hotspots

Production is decentralized across India to minimize transport costs and maximize local employment:

  • Jaipur (Rajasthan): Home to the Kumarappa National Handmade Paper Institute, where the technology was developed.
  • Chhattisgarh: Leading the country in production through its Gauthan (cattle shed) initiatives.
  • Odisha, Uttar Pradesh, and Tamil Nadu: Seeing a rise in private entrepreneurs and KVIC-licensed units.

Cow dung paint is more than just a decorative choice; it is a bridge between India’s agricultural heritage and its sustainable future. By turning a byproduct into a premium building material, it addresses environmental pollution while putting money directly back into the pockets of rural farmers.

Benefits of Prakritik Paint https://sidvig.com/benefits-of-prakritik-paint/ Tue, 03 Feb 2026 16:37:50 +0000 https://sidvig.com/blog/?p=114 It’s great that you’re looking into Prakritik Paint (cow dung-based paint). It’s one of those rare “back to basics” innovations that actually solves a lot of modern problems. Developed by Khadi and Village Industries Commission (KVIC), it’s essentially a bridge between traditional Indian wisdom and modern construction needs.+1

Here is a breakdown of why it’s gaining so much traction:


1. Eco-Friendly & Non-Toxic

Unlike conventional oil or plastic-based paints, Prakritik paint is heavy metal-free.

  • Zero Lead and Mercury: Most commercial paints contain traces of these, which can be harmful over long-term exposure.
  • Low VOCs: Volatile Organic Compounds are those “new paint smells” that cause headaches and respiratory issues. This paint is virtually odorless and much safer for indoor air quality.+1

2. Natural Thermal Insulation

One of its coolest (literally) features is its ability to regulate temperature.

  • Heat Reflectant: It acts as a natural insulator. In the peak of summer, surfaces coated with Prakritik paint can be 3°C to 5°C cooler than those with standard synthetic paints.

3. Anti-Bacterial & Anti-Fungal

Cow dung has been used in Indian households for centuries for its purifying properties. Science backs this up:

  • Natural Protection: The paint has inherent anti-fungal and anti-bacterial properties, preventing the growth of mold and lichen on your walls even in humid conditions.

4. Cost-Effective & Durable

You might expect a “niche” product to be expensive, but it’s actually quite the opposite.

  • Budget-Friendly: It is generally cheaper than premium emulsion paints offered by big brands.
  • Longevity: It offers a smooth, matte finish that is surprisingly durable and dries in just about 4 hours.

5. Socio-Economic Impact

By choosing this paint, you aren’t just helping your walls; you’re helping a larger ecosystem:

  • Farmer Support: It creates a new revenue stream for farmers and gaushalas (cowsheds) by putting a value on bovine waste.
  • Rural Employment: Most production units are designed to boost local manufacturing in rural areas.
